Shanmugam and US congressmen affirm bilateral relations

SINGAPORE - On Monday morning, a United States congressional delegation met Minister for Foreign Affairs and Minister for Law K Shanmugam.

During the meeting, Minister Shanmugam and the congressional delegation affirmed the excellent bilateral relations between Singapore and the US.

Minister Shanmugam welcomed the US' commitment to continue deepening its engagement with the Asia-Pacific region.

The two parties exchanged views on regional and international developments, including the progress of the Trans-Pacific Partnership (TPP) negotiations.

The TPP is an investment treaty which currently has 12 countries participating including Singapore, Malaysia, Japan, Australia and the US.

Both sides underscored the importance of the successful conclusion of the TPP Agreement.

The Congressional delegation will also call on Deputy Prime Minister and Minister for Finance Tharman Shanmugaratnam and Minister for Trade & Industry Lim Hng Kiang today.

The delegation is in Singapore from Feb 15 to 17, 2015.
